FIL 202

American Film History II (1950—present)

Catalog description

The course covers post World War II films, American New Wave in the 1960s and 1970s, the emergence of the age of American auteurs, and the consolidation of the industry into a global phenomenon. Topics include feminism, black liberation and the student movement; the rise of the blockbuster; and the independent challenge to dominant cinema that has become part of mainstream cinema today.
